Understanding Female Infertility

Female infertility refers to a woman’s inability to conceive after one year of regular, unprotected intercourse (or six months if over 35). It affects approximately 10-15% of couples worldwide.

Endometriosis

Our approach to endometriosis combines laparoscopic surgery to remove endometrial lesions with hormonal treatments to prevent recurrence. For those with severe endometriosis, we offer specialized IVF protocols to maximize success rates.

Polycystic Ovary Syndrome (PCOS)

Our PCOS management integrates lifestyle modifications, medication for ovulation induction, and advanced reproductive technologies when needed. Our holistic approach addresses both fertility and the metabolic aspects of PCOS.

Tubal Factor Infertility

For blocked or damaged fallopian tubes, we offer both surgical repair options and IVF treatments to bypass the tubes entirely. Our advanced microsurgical techniques can restore tubal function in suitable cases.
